Beth buys a television priced at $841.10. Shipping and handling are an additional 10% of the price.
How much shipping and handling will Beth pay?
Solution
1. ### Break Down the Problem
To find the total shipping and handling cost, we need to compute 10% of the television price.

4. ### Verify and Summarize
The calculated shipping and handling fee is $84.11. We can verify this by confirming that multiplying the original price by 10% consistently yields this result.
Final Answer
Beth will pay $84.11 for shipping and handling.
